Q: Is 11,235,547 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 11,235,547 is a composite number.

Why is 11,235,547 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 11,235,547 can be evenly divided by 1 31 59 1,829 6,143 190,433 362,437 and 11,235,547, with no remainder.

Since 11,235,547 cannot be divided by just 1 and 11,235,547, it is a composite number.
